Purpose

This document enumerates the formal governance artifacts that define authority, accountability, separation of powers, and risk mitigation across Africa’s EdTech Breakthrough Project. Each artifact specifies its mandate, scope, authority holder, and lifecycle status.


1. AUDA-NEPAD African EdTech 2030: Vision & Plan

Mandate: Continental policy vision for digital education.
Authority Holder: African Union (via AUDA-NEPAD).
Scope: Policy intent and outcomes; no implementation endorsement.
Status: Approved. Launched in final form at the AU STI Week, Addis Ababa, February 2026.


2. Policy Framework for Standards-Based, Vendor-Neutral EdTech

Mandate: Principles guiding interoperable, vendor-neutral digital education systems.
Authority Holder: African Union (via AUDA-NEPAD).
Scope: Policy and procurement alignment.
Status: Approved.


3. DPI-Ed Specification Layer

Mandate: Define the functional requirements of a DPI for Education.
Authority Holder: AUDA-NEPAD (policy intent); global DPI community (evolving norms).
Scope: Specification layer only.
Status: Endorsed at policy level.


4. GovStack Education Working Group Participation

Mandate: Evolve DPI-Ed building blocks for multi-country usability, with Africa leading on low-resource delivery requirements.
Authority Holder: GovStack Consortium; joined by Spix Foundation.
Scope: Technical specification evolution and guidance.
Status: Ongoing.


5. RESPECT Platform Stewardship Charter

Mandate: Technical stewardship of the RESPECT reference implementation.
Authority Holder: Spix Foundation.
Scope: Codebase maintenance, releases, and interoperability.
Status: Active.


6. RESPECT Ecosystem Stewardship Charter

Mandate: Stewardship of the RESPECT Ecosystem and its economic sustainability.
Authority Holder: Spix Foundation.
Scope: Ecosystem integrity, revenue mechanisms, geographic expansion, and brand protection.
Status: Active.


7. RESPECT Trademark & Brand Governance Policy

Mandate: Protect the RESPECT trademark as the funding engine of the Platform.
Authority Holder: Spix Foundation.
Scope: Licensing, compliance, and enforcement.
Status: Active.


8. RESPECT Compatible Product Associations (Framework)

Mandate: Independent governance of certified products by category.
Authority Holder: Respective Associations (with Spix Golden Veto for brand protection).
Scope: Certification standards and compliance.
Status: In formation (Tranche 1).


9. RESPECT Certified Impletor / Partner Program

Mandate: Certify “Boots on the Ground” for pilots and roll-outs.
Authority Holder: Spix Foundation.
Scope: Training, certification, and quality assurance.
Status: In formation (Tranche 1).


10. DPI Engineer Professional Body

Mandate: Define and certify the DPI Engineer discipline.
Authority Holder: Independent professional body (incubated by Spix).
Scope: Curriculum, exams, certification.
Status: In formation (Tranche 1).


11. AUDA-NEPAD EdTech Task Force Secretariat

Mandate: Time-bounded continental coordination and policy domestication.
Authority Holder: AUDA-NEPAD.
Scope: Coordination only; no platform control.
Status: Planned / Time-bounded.


12. Fiduciary Trustee Arrangements

Mandate: Custody and disbursement of donor funds against verified milestones.
Authority Holder: Appointed fiduciary (TBD; candidates include IsDB, World Bank, AfDB, BADEA, with Global South preference).
Scope: Project funds; milestone-gated disbursement.
Status: Planned, to be chosen by Project Convenor & AUDA-NEPAD.


13. Independent Auditor (IA) Framework

Mandate: Verify milestone achievement and outcomes.
Authority Holder: Appointed Independent Auditors.
Scope: Output verification; no operational authority.
Status: Planned for Tranche 1.


14. Sponsor Credits (SpoDits) Governance Framework

Mandate: Regulate sponsorship-funded support for free products and localizations.
Authority Holder: Spix Foundation; fiduciary oversight for initial period.
Scope: Revenue allocation, compliance, and reporting.
Status: In formation (Tranche 1).


15. Legacy Attribution Framework

Mandate: Maintain an accurate, bounded historical record of foundational and scaling contributions.
Authority Holder: Project Convenor.
Operational Custodian: Independent Historian (retained by Convenor).
Scope: Attribution only; no governance or financial rights.
Status: Active.


16. Spin-Out & Handoff Protocols

Mandate: Govern the transition of incubated bodies to independent entities.
Authority Holder: Spix Foundation (execution); receiving entities (post-handoff).
Scope: Product Associations, professional bodies.
Status: Planned (Tranche 1 completion).


17. Stakeholder Alignment Programs

Mandate: Align incentives and adoption across all stakeholder categories.
Authority Holder: Spix Foundation.
Scope: Ministries of Education (MoEs), Non-MoE Schools, App Developers, Localizers, Certified Impletors & Partners, Educators, Researchers, MNOs, Funders.
Status: Active.


18. Board Governance of the Spix Foundation

Mandate: Oversight of Spix operations.
Authority Holder: Spix Foundation Board of Directors.
Scope: Organizational governance.
Status: Active (Board expansion in progress).


Summary

These artifacts collectively define a governance system designed to minimize capture, ensure accountability, preserve sovereignty, and enable durable scale—while maintaining strict separation between policy authority, implementation, funding, and recognition.
